Geography is an optional subject in the secondary schools in Nepal. This study examines the challenges of using instructional materials in the teaching of geography in community secondary schools in Kathmandu district of Bagmati Province. Eight geography teachers were selected on the basis of purposive sampling out of community schools offering geography as an optional subject. The semi structured interview method are used for data collection. The interviews are recorded on an audio recorder and then after transcribed. The data were categorized from the raw data and tables were constructed with frequency. After collecting data, analysis of the data acquired was made through the interpretative method. The results reveals that the challenges of using instructional materials are non-availability of materials, laziness of the teachers, lack of skill and strategies, financial constraint, lack of appropriate materials in textbook, time constraint, lack of support from authority, lack of geography resource room etc. The remedies of the challenges of using instructional materials are the organizing of training and workshop for teachers on how to use instructional materials, provision of funds by the authorities and government, regular supervision, the improvisation of the local materials and the provision of the various instructional materials which are necessary for teaching etc.
